WARNING: DURING TRACTOR DISCONNECTION, CLOSED-CIRCUIT AIR CONDI-
TIONING SYSTEM MAY BE DETACHED BY MEANS OF SEPARATION OF A QUICK
DISCONNECT COUPLER. DISCONNECTION SHALL BE PERFORMED BY UNSCREW-
ING CAP NUT "B" (FIGURE 6.15.1) (WITH HEXAGON SCREW KEY SIZE 30MM) FROM
VALVE "A" (WITH HEXAGON SCREW KEY SIZE 29 MM)! WHILE CONNECTING THE
DUCT, IT IS NECESSARY TO PUT SILICONE SEALANT ON THE THREAD. AFTER
THREE OR FIVE DISCONNECTIONS A LEAKAGE CAN OCCUR IN THE JUNCTION
POINT – IN THIS CASE IT SHALL BE REPLACED!
WARNING: WHILE DISCONNECTION AND CONNECTION OF DUCTS, WEAR PRO-
TECTIVE GLOVES AND GLASSES!
WARNING: ANY OPERATIONS RELATED TO DISCONNECTION OF AIR CONDITION-
ING SYSTEM COMPONENTS SHALL BE CARRIED OUT ONLY BY TRAINED PER-
SONNEL WITH USE OF SPECIAL EQUIPMENT FOR AIR CONDITIONING SYSTEM
MAINTENANCE. HIGH PRESSURE IS MAINTAINED EVEN IN THE SHUT SYSTEM!
WARNING: COOLING AGENT R134A IS NON TOXIC, NON COMBUSTIBLE, NOT
FORMING EXPLOSIVE MIXTURES. COOLING AGENT BOILING TEMPERATURE UN-
DER NORMAL CONDITIONS IS MINUS 27  С. IN CASE OF SKIN CONTACT WITH LIQ-
UID COOLING AGENT, IT FLASHES AND CAN CAUSE OVERCOOLING OF SKIN ARE-
AS!
WARNING: ONLY SPECIALLY TRAINED PERSONNEL IS ALLOWED TO PERFORM
REPAIR AND MAINTENANCE SERVICES OF SYSTEM COMPONENTS!
